Subject: Greenacre Franchise Agreement – Status

Team,

Franchise agreement with the Greenacre operator is at final draft. Royalty set at 5.5%, marketing levy 1.5%, ten-year term with one renewal option. Finance to confirm fee schedule and working-capital requirement by Friday. Signing targeted for month-end. No changes to the standard territory clause. Flag issues to Priya directly. The confidential planning note is appended below.

internal memo for faweg-tafog: Only 7 of the 100 pilot accounts renewed Quenael, so a churn review is set for April 15.

## Artifact Signing — StageGrid Seat-Map Renderer

All builds of the StageGrid renderer used by the Orpheum Pavilion box office must be signed before deploy. The CI pipeline at Velvetline produces a tarball of the WebGL bundle, computes its digest, and attaches a detached signature. Unsigned artifacts are rejected by the venue kiosk updater, which caused last Tuesday's rollback. Verification happens at install time against the pinned public key. For the weekly sync, note that the current signing key is as follows.

release key, bajep-fahap: bky3_pY3

Handover for facilities desk: the Marrowgate intern cohort arrives Monday, 14 people, 09:00. Temp passes are printed and sorted in the grey tray. Verity from People Ops is meeting them in the atrium and walking them to Training Room 4. Keep the east turnstile on manual until they're through. Lockers 30–44 are reserved; keys are tagged. If Verity is late, hold them at the atrium. Training Room 4 stays locked — open it with the pass below.

turnstile pass: bdg-NG-3